Addis Ababa: The Permanent Representative of Ethiopia to the African Union and UNECA, Ambassador Hirut Zemene, presented her Letters of Credence to the Chairperson of the African Union Commission, Moussa Faki Mahamat today. On the occasion, the two sides exchanged views on a range of issues including the progress of the ongoing Institutional Reforms of the African Union and strengthening cooperation between Ethiopia and the AU, according to Foreign Affairs Ministry. Ambassador Hirut reiterated Ethiopia's continued commitment to support the African Union in its endeavors. Source: Ethiopian News Agency
